My Buying Guides on Sports Research D3 K2 Review

Why I Considered Sports Research D3 K2

When I started looking for a vitamin D3 and K2 supplement, I wanted something simple, reliable, and easy to take daily. Sports Research D3 K2 stood out to me because it combines both nutrients in one softgel, which made my routine easier. I also liked that it seemed to focus on clean ingredients and a straightforward formula.

What I Looked For Before Buying

Before I bought it, I paid attention to a few things:

  • The amount of vitamin D3 per serving
  • The type and amount of K2 included
  • Ingredient quality
  • Whether it was easy to swallow
  • How well it fit into my daily supplement routine

For me, a supplement has to be convenient and trustworthy, or I know I won’t stay consistent with it.
